enic: fix lockdep around devcmd_lock



We were experiencing occasional "BUG: scheduling while atomic" splats
in our testing. Enabling DEBUG_SPINLOCK and DEBUG_LOCKDEP in the kernel
exposed a lockdep in the enic driver.

enic 0000:0b:00.0 eth2: Link UP

======================================================
[ INFO: SOFTIRQ-safe -> SOFTIRQ-unsafe lock order detected ]
3.12.0-rc1.x86_64-dbg+ #2 Tainted: GF       W
------------------------------------------------------
NetworkManager/4209 [HC0[0]:SC0[2]:HE1:SE0] is trying to acquire:
(&(&enic->devcmd_lock)->rlock){+.+...}, at: [<ffffffffa026b7e4>] enic_dev_packet_filter+0x44/0x90 [enic]

The fix was to replace spin_lock with spin_lock_bh for the enic
devcmd_lock, so that soft irqs would be disabled while the lock
is held.
